Nutrition Facts per 100g
| Water | 60.3 | G |
| Energy | 241 | KCAL |
| Protein | 13.6 | G |
| Total lipid (fat) | 18.7 | G |
| Carbohydrate, by difference | 4.0 | G |
| Fiber, total dietary | 0 | G |
| Total Sugars | 0 | G |
| Cholesterol | 58.0 | MG |
| Vitamin C, total ascorbic acid | 0 | MG |
| Thiamin | 0.60 | MG |
| Riboflavin | 0.19 | MG |
| Niacin | 3.5 | MG |
| Vitamin B-6 | 0.26 | MG |
| Folate, total | 3.0 | UG |
| Vitamin B-12 | 0.81 | UG |
| Vitamin A, RAE | 0 | UG |
| Vitamin E (alpha-tocopherol) | 0.27 | MG |
| Vitamin D (D2 + D3) | 1.1 | UG |
| Vitamin K (phylloquinone) | 0 | UG |
| Calcium, Ca | 58.0 | MG |
| Iron, Fe | 0.91 | MG |
| Magnesium, Mg | 16.0 | MG |
| Phosphorus, P | 253 | MG |
| Potassium, K | 294 | MG |
| Sodium, Na | 1000 | MG |
| Zinc, Zn | 2.0 | MG |
| Copper, Cu | 0.08 | MG |
| Selenium, Se | 34.6 | UG |
| Energy | 1010 | kJ |
| Ash | 3.4 | G |
| Fluoride, F | 36.3 | UG |
| Pantothenic acid | 0.52 | MG |
| Folic acid | 0 | UG |
| Folate, food | 3.0 | UG |
| Folate, DFE | 3.0 | UG |
| Choline, total | 66.3 | MG |
| Betaine | 6.5 | MG |
| Vitamin B-12, added | 0 | UG |
| Retinol | 0 | UG |
| Carotene, beta | 0 | UG |
| Carotene, alpha | 0 | UG |
| Cryptoxanthin, beta | 0 | UG |
| Vitamin A, IU | 0 | IU |
| Lycopene | 0 | UG |
| Lutein + zeaxanthin | 0 | UG |
| Vitamin E, added | 0 | MG |
| Vitamin D (D2 + D3), International Units | 44.0 | IU |
| Fatty acids, total saturated | 7.0 | G |
| SFA 4:0 | 0 | G |
| SFA 6:0 | 0 | G |
| SFA 8:0 | 0 | G |
| SFA 10:0 | 0.07 | G |
| SFA 12:0 | 0.07 | G |
| SFA 14:0 | 0.39 | G |
| SFA 16:0 | 4.2 | G |
| SFA 18:0 | 2.2 | G |
| Fatty acids, total monounsaturated | 8.6 | G |
| MUFA 16:1 | 0.67 | G |
| MUFA 18:1 | 7.9 | G |
| MUFA 20:1 | 0 | G |
| MUFA 22:1 | 0 | G |
| Fatty acids, total polyunsaturated | 2.0 | G |
| PUFA 18:2 | 1.8 | G |
| PUFA 18:3 | 0.25 | G |
| PUFA 18:4 | 0 | G |
| PUFA 20:4 | 0 | G |
| PUFA 20:5 n-3 (EPA) | 0 | G |
| PUFA 22:5 n-3 (DPA) | 0 | G |
| PUFA 22:6 n-3 (DHA) | 0 | G |
| Phytosterols | 0 | MG |
| Tryptophan | 0.21 | G |
| Threonine | 0.72 | G |
| Isoleucine | 0.75 | G |
| Leucine | 1.4 | G |
| Lysine | 1.5 | G |
| Methionine | 0.44 | G |
| Cystine | 0.23 | G |
| Phenylalanine | 0.69 | G |
| Tyrosine | 0.56 | G |
| Valine | 0.80 | G |
| Arginine | 1.1 | G |
| Histidine | 0.68 | G |
| Alanine | 0.91 | G |
| Aspartic acid | 1.6 | G |
| Glutamic acid | 2.6 | G |
| Glycine | 0.75 | G |
| Proline | 0.79 | G |
| Serine | 0.67 | G |
| Alcohol, ethyl | 0 | G |
| Caffeine | 0 | MG |
| Theobromine | 0 | MG |
